Welcome to NYC Personal Trainer Curvy Goddess Workout on video. This is Week #2 of the Crystal Series. Each video is approximately 10 minutes long. I have a natural pace on the videos but I want you to focus on your natural pace. Don’t try to keep up with me. I want your movements to be conscious and controlled, making sure that you’re in touch with what you’re feeling when you’re doing the movements.
I’d like you to start with 3 days/week with both Part 1 and 2. You may do the workouts everyday if you wish. Don’t be preoccupied with having to take a day break to rest body parts etc. etc. They are 10 min. long — very short and sweet. The focus for the Crystal Series is to get the body used to just moving again — how it’s designed to do.

Fat Burning Video – Part 1:
- Resistance Band – Medium
- Pair of Dumbbells (1-3 lbs)
- Chair or Workout Bench
Exercise #1: Sit Down, Stand Up bringing the arms up when you stand up. (You may intensify the movement by holding the dumbbells.)
Exercise #2: Alternating Shoulder Presses with dumbbells.
Exercise #3: Standing Resistance Band Rows (Stand in the middle of bands to secure in place. Cross the handles and bend over pulling back and squeezing the shoulder blades together.)
You want to go through the 3 exercises back-to-back to keep heart rate up for fat burning and cardiovascular results.
Equipment Needed:
Firming Video – Part 2:
- Mat
- Pilates Ring
Exercise #1: Inner Thigh Squeezes with Pilates Ring
Exercise #2: Bridges keeping Pilates Ring between the Thighs
Exercise #3: Taps (Bring Knees into Chest – Alternating)
